Role Overview
This role focuses on applying the ServiceNow platform to telecom network and IT operations, specifically across high-growth modules such as Service Provider Management Toolkit (SPMT), Telecommunications Network Inventory (TNI), and Now Assist (GenAI).
You will lead architecture, delivery, and pre-sales for these specialized solutions, helping large-scale network operators move toward autonomous operations.
Key Responsibilities
Platform Architecture & Design
● Architect SPMT solutions for end-to-end service lifecycle management — including service design, activation, assurance, and fulfilment integrated with OSS/BSS stacks
● Design and implement TNI solutions for network resource inventory, including discovery, reconciliation, ( NeDR) and service mapping across physical and virtual network layers
● Lead Now Assist implementations, including GenAI skill configuration, prompt design, and governance for NOC/SOC and IT helpdesk use cases
● Define integration patterns between ServiceNow and network management systems (EMS/NMS), ITSM tools, and field operations platforms
